Ostrich farming 1st became into being because of an expedition to find ostriches to exploit their feathers. These types of wild ostriches were captured in the East of Africa and moved to S. africa to be trained and farmed. This occurred in the early 18th Century.

Farmers uncovered by grouping ostriches, they can get the feathers more often. The first exports of ostrich feathers took place in 1838 but it was not until 1863 that ostrich farming became a reality.

Around the same time, the farming development of producing lucerne through irrigation permitted the necessary feed for the farmers. This enabled a rather dry area such as Oudtshoorn the opportunity of being self sufficient for ostrich feed, and certainly assisted the development of the livestock farming industry in that area.

Such was the nice income from feathers, by 1913 feathers had become the fourth largest revenue earner for South Africa, behind gold, diamonds and wool. It was from such income that the owners constructed their impressive homes known as feather palaces, bringing in building materials and decor from abroad at exuberant costs. Quality was the order of the day as each feather palace attempted to outdo its neighbor in style and elegance.

It was then the fashion industry that was the key factor for the progress of the feather market, but as fashions come and go, so did the desire for the ostrich feather. Hats that decorated ostrich feathers no much longer became practical. It was difficult to keep such a hat on a motor car, the new transportation method to come out during the 20th Century. As the men folks went to war, females also had to take on the role of manual labor, and practical clothing became a necessity. Items considered superfluous such as feather hats went out of style. Therefore the great collapse in desire for ostrich feathers led to the death of the ostrich farming industry.

It had been only after the world wars, that the ostrich raising group started out to look into the ostrich leather industry. First transferring their skins to London, UK to get tanned, and then later on, adding the knowledge to suntan themselves, ostrich leather was marketed as a luxury product. Stuff such as handbags were made from ostrich leather using its distinctive follicle pattern so that it is an unique leather, easily identifiable and both strong and pliable. Fashion houses indexed on the trend and launched ostrich leather items in their collections as expensive items.
